Educational Program Developer
1 week ago
We are looking for a highly qualified and experienced Registered Montessori preschool teacher to join our team at Marshwood Montessori Preschool.
About Us:We are a family-owned, small preschool with a beautiful big natural backyard and playground, along with two newly renovated classrooms.
Our Centre Director will support you in your role, providing guidance and resources to help you develop and achieve your goals.
About You:To succeed in this role, you will need:
- A Certificate in early childhood education.
- Montessori certification and previous experience teaching in a Montessori setting.
- Strong communication skills and ability to work well in a team.
- A passion for working with young children and commitment to providing quality education.
- Continuing to create a nurturing and stimulating learning environment for children aged 2 to 6 years old.
- Developing and implementing Montessori-based curriculum and lesson plans for early childhood education.
- Observing and documenting each child's progress and providing feedback to parents/guardians.
- Collaborating with other teachers and staff members to ensure a cohesive and supportive learning environment.
